In this webinar, Dr Sarah Bickerton and Mandy Henk break down in plain language what the recent developments in AI are, what they may mean for education, and importantly, what some strategies might be that teachers and schools can use to engage effectively with AI.
Dr Sarah Hendrica Bickerton is a lecturer in Public Policy and Technology with the Public Policy Institute at Waipapa Taumata Rau | University of Auckland. She has a deep academic background as a sociologist with expertise in technology, policy, and gender. Her PhD research was on political participation behaviours amongst women Twitter users.
Mandy Henk is a librarian, writer, and the chief executive of Tohatoha, a charity that supports New Zealand to become a digital nation with a digitally sophisticated population.
